Grow a mango tree in your balcony garden and enjoy the sweet fruit at home

Now, not having a garden doesn’t mean that you won’t have the taste of fresh, homegrown mangoes. With some planning and care, it is possible to grow your own mango tree on your terrace or balcony, even if the space is limited. The idea may seem unbelievable, but it is completely doable. With the right amount of sunlight, soil, and time, your balcony can turn into an orchard. The idea of plucking your own mangoes from your balcony or your garden is simply delightful.

How to grow a mango tree in a balcony garden

Not only can a mango tree be grown in a container, but experts say it can be done. This is especially recommended for those with limited space. This, according to Biology Insights, can be done especially if one has limited space at home. This is especially recommended for urban homes. This is because the varieties, like Carrie and Cogshall, are dwarf and can be contained. In fact, this can be done by container gardening, which can be controlled.

Best way to grow a mango tree in a pot

In order to grow a mango tree in the home garden, the following are the essential factors that make all the difference:

  • The choice of the mango variety: Dwarf mango trees are between 4 and 8 feet in height and are ideal for container gardening.
  • The container size: A medium-sized container should be chosen, and the size should be increased as the plant grows.
  • The drainage of the container: Mango plant roots cannot tolerate waterlogged conditions.
  • The choice of the soil: A light, nutrient-rich, and well-draining soil mix should be chosen.

It has also been suggested by experts that the size of the container should be increased gradually and not chosen too large in the first place, in order to prevent the problem of root rot.

Sunlight, water and care tips for healthy growth

Mango plants love the sun. Since they are originally from India, they love the tropical weather.For best results:

  • Position the plant in an area where it will receive 6-8 hours of sun daily
  • Water the plant regularly, but not too much
  • Use fertiliser on the plant during the growing season

Mango plants are not fond of cold. If the temperature goes below 4°C, the flowers will not develop properly.

How long before you get mangoes

Growing mangoes is a patient process, but the payoff is well worth the wait. If you are using a grafted mango, you can expect it to bear fruit within a few years. However, if you are growing it from a mango seed, it might take a lot longer.While the yield from a container-grown mango tree might be less than that of a tree planted directly in the ground, the fruit is certainly delicious.The advantages of growing a mango tree in a container are obvious—no need to have a large garden to enjoy the deliciousness of homegrown mangoes!
